Congressman Robert Hurt’s Weekly Column
This past week I held a jobs roundtable with nearly 60 local small business leaders in Danville to talk about the House of Representatives’ pro-growth jobs plan and to hear from our true job creators about ways to help jumpstart our economy.
5th District Virginians from Danville, Pittsylvania, Halifax, Martinsville, Henry, and Franklin attended the roundtable, and the overwhelming message I heard from these small business leaders was that the crushing regulatory environment coming out of Washington is stifling growth and hindering job creation.
